Optimizing Performance in Large Language Models
Wiki Article
Large language models (LLMs) are achieving remarkable feats, but their performance can often be hindered by various factors. One key aspect of optimization involves carefully selecting the appropriate training data.
This data should be extensive and applicable to the targeted tasks the LLM is designed for. Another crucial factor is tuning the model's configurations. Through iterative experimentation, practitioners can discover the best parameter values to maximize the LLM's fidelity.
Furthermore, structures of LLMs play a crucial role in their performance. Researchers are constantly researching cutting-edge architectures that can augment the model's potential.
Finally, hardware capabilities are essential for training and deploying LLMs effectively. Utilizing powerful computing infrastructure can shorten the training process and enable the creation of larger and more capable models.
Scaling Model Training for Enterprise Applications
Training deep learning models for enterprise applications often requires significant computational resources and infrastructure. As model complexity expands, the extent of data required for training also soars. This presents a major challenge for organizations aiming to leverage the power of AI at scale.
To tackle this hurdle, enterprises are utilizing various strategies for scaling model training.
One approach is to deploy cloud computing platforms that offer flexible infrastructure on demand. This allows organizations to acquire the necessary compute power and storage resources as needed, improving cost efficiency.
Another crucial aspect of scaling model training is data management. Enterprises need to implement robust data pipelines that can handle significant datasets efficiently. This involves approaches such as data preprocessing, feature engineering, and concurrent processing to speed up the training process.
Additionally, advanced training methodologies like model parallelism and parameter quantization are being employed to minimize training time and resource consumption. These strategies allow for the fragmentation of models across multiple cores, enabling faster convergence and more efficient utilization of hardware.
By implementing a combination of these strategies, enterprises can effectively scale model training for their specific applications, unlocking the full potential of AI in their operations.
Strategic Resource Management for Major Model Deployment
Deploying major deep learning frameworks at scale demands a meticulous approach to resource allocation. To ensure smooth operation and maximize performance, it's crucial to allocate efficiently computational resources such as CPU, GPU, and memory. Adaptive resource provisioning mechanisms here are essential for responding to fluctuations in demand and preventing bottlenecks.
Additionally, careful consideration must be given to network infrastructure, storage capacity, and data processing pipelines to facilitate seamless training of the deployed models.
Monitoring and Maintaining Large-Scale Model Ecosystems
Successfully navigating the complexities of large-scale model ecosystems demands a robust strategy for both tracking and maintenance. This entails implementing comprehensive tools to assess model performance, pinpoint potential problems, and address risks before they worsen. A key aspect of this process involves ongoing assessment of model results against predefined standards. Furthermore, it's crucial to establish clear protocols for recalibrating models based on dynamic data and feedback.
- Regular audits of model structure can reveal areas for improvement.
- Cooperation between developers and domain authorities is essential for confirming model accuracy.
Ultimately, the goal of monitoring and maintaining large-scale model ecosystems is to guarantee their long-term robustness and performance in delivering meaningful insights.
Ethical Considerations in Major Model Management
Managing large language models presents a range of moral challenges. These models have the capacity to amplify existing societal discriminations, and their outputs can sometimes be misleading. Furthermore, there are concerns about accountability in the development of these models. It's essential to establish standards that ensure these powerful technologies are used conscientiously.
- Key consideration is the need for impartiality in model implementation. Models should be trained on diverse datasets to minimize the risk of discrimination against certain groups.
- Additionally, it's crucial to ensure that models are explainable. This means being able to analyze how a model arrives at its decisions. Transparency is key to building confidence in these systems.
- In conclusion, ongoing evaluation is important to identify and address any emerging challenges. This includes collecting feedback from users and stakeholders, and making modifications as needed.
Best Practices for Collaborative Model Development
Effective teamwork is paramount when developing models collaboratively. A well-defined structure provides a roadmap for all contributors, outlining roles, responsibilities, and communication channels.
Frequent meetings facilitate knowledge sharing and ensure everyone stays aligned. Utilize project management tools to track changes, prevent overwrites, and maintain a transparent development history.
Foster an environment of transparency where team members feel comfortable proposing solutions. Celebrate successes and identify areas for improvement to continuously enhance the model's performance.
Report this wiki page